One of the most attracting features of the doctrine of Grace is that is cuts through all the 'isms' the human mind can invent. We cannot opinionate the gift of God for man's salvation, the exclusion of any deed to make us deserve it or the power of the subsequent relationship Grace gives us.

Grace cuts through it all. And it is the one thing that will unite all heaven dwellers, no matter what their 'isms'. 

Grace, the best common denominator to all the 'isms'. And the greatest equalizer.
